Alongside the HRM-9, the Warzone Season 1 Reloaded update also introduced the TAQ Evolvere. This unique light machine gun is based on the FN Evolys and much like its real-world counterpart can be chambered in both 5.56 and 7.62.
Its performance in Warzone is that of a more mobile LMG but it still offers both a good damage profile and unbelievable damage range. This latter strength is due to its accuracy which also makes it one of the easiest guns to use in CoD’s battle royale.

Best TAQ Evolvere Warzone loadout
- Muzzle: Casus Brake L
- Barrel: LRF Righteous Long Barrel
- Optic: Aim OP-V4
- Stock: SA Kilonova Stock
- Rear Grip: JUP_JP20_LM_EVICTOR_PGRIP_AIM
The TAQ Evolvere’s biggest strength is its performance at long range with the LMG being extremely accurate. To make the most of this it’s best to maximize Aiming Stability using the SA Kilonova Stock and bizarrely named JUP_JP20_LM_EVICTOR_PGRIP_AIM rear grip.
Although its recoil is undoubtedly brilliant it never hurts to improve it further. For this, the Casus Brake L muzzle works well effectively giving the TAQ Evolvere a perfectly vertical recoil spray pattern. With this attachment, the LMG becomes easy to control even for lesser-skill players.
With the Evolvere being a medium to long-range weapon an optic is a given with the Aim OP-V4 making a lot of sense, although the meta Corio Eagleseye 2.5x is an equally great choice. Finally, the LRF Righteous Long Barrel provides a big boost to damage range while also slightly improving recoil.

TAQ Evolvere Warzone Loadout: Perks and Equipment
- Perk 1: Sleight of Hand
- Perk 2: EOD
- Perk 3: Survivor
- Perk 4: High Alert
- Lethal: Drill Charge
- Tactical: Scatter Mine
With it being an LMG the TAQ Evolvere suffers from its brutally long reload time of over eight seconds which can leave you vulnerable. Sleight of Hand offsets by speeding up reloads significantly. For Perk 2, the buffed EOD will save your life from enemy explosives and launcher shots making it a strong option.
In Perk slot 3, Survivor is an underrated choice that not only reduces the delay before health regen begins but also speeds up revives. This lets you play as a medic of sorts as you watch over your team making the most of the TAQ Evolvere’s fantastic range.
High Alert is always a strong choice with the Perk 4 providing intel in the form of strobe warnings whenever an enemy aims in your direction. This not only lets you know where other teams are but also greatly increases your odds of preemptively dodging a potentially fatal shot.
For equipment, we choose two options that provide utility for both playing aggressively and controlling an area for when a slower playstyle is preferred. A Drill Charge is used to push other teams and flush them out of cover while a Scatter Mine can be placed to scout for enemies trying to flank you.
How to unlock TAQ Evolvere in Warzone
The TAQ Evolvere is unlocked by completing any 5 challenges from the Week 7 weekly challenges across multiplayer, zombies, and Warzone. Once Season 1 has ended the LMG will be available through the Armory instead.
Best alternative to TAQ Evolvere in Warzone
Given its similarities, it’s no surprise that the TAQ Evolvere has a lot in common with the TAQ Eradicator. Both are accurate LMGs that excel at medium to long-range are are best known for their ease of use.
